Average value

Short description
The average value function calculates the average value of an analog input over a configured
time period.

Description
En
A change in status from 0 to 1 transition at input En
starts the average value function.
A change in status from 1 to 0 at input En holds the
analog output value.
R
A signal at input R clears the analog output value.
Ax
Input Ax is one of the following analog signals:
